>> I like Geany and have been tweaking a few of the syntax highlight
>> settings to my liking.  One thing I've not figured out is how I might
>> highlight a line that begins with 'dnl' similar to a shell comment but
>> with another color, if possible.
>>
>> I understand that .m4 and configure.ac filetypes are part of the .sh
>> type which is fine.  I suppose that 'dnl' could be considered a keyword
>> but I would rather the entire line be highlighted.
>
> No ideas on this?  I've tried various things based on what I've found in the
> various filetypes.* files, but the only thing that I could seem to do is
> highlight 'dnl' as a keyword, but I'd like it to be treated as a comment line so
> geany doesn't try to parse the line for backticks and quotes.
>
> Is this something that should be a wishlist bug?
>

Hi,

I *think* it's a Scintilla issue, not changeable from Geany itself, but 
I could be wrong though, as I've proven numerous times :)
